Output 07691cd0cbebcaf66cabcdae242010061585aa56954c8d43c5a65ec0204fe91d:42

value
1262000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df9b0afd56045b0faf13155cbd7e90cd3585e99 OP_EQUAL
address
32xuppFxmfVfz9w9C44gx8eFrPKQNMXqZ4
transaction
07691cd0cbebcaf66cabcdae242010061585aa56954c8d43c5a65ec0204fe91d
confirmations
213238
spent
true